| /linux-6.15/tools/testing/selftests/arm64/fp/ |
| H A D | Makefile | 13 za-fork za-ptrace 19 za-test \ 23 TEST_PROGS_EXTENDED := fpsimd-stress sve-stress ssve-stress za-stress 25 EXTRA_CLEAN += $(OUTPUT)/asm-utils.o $(OUTPUT)/rdvl.o $(OUTPUT)/za-fork-asm.o 43 $(OUTPUT)/za-fork: za-fork.c $(OUTPUT)/za-fork-asm.o 47 $(OUTPUT)/za-ptrace: za-ptrace.c 48 $(OUTPUT)/za-test: za-test.S $(OUTPUT)/asm-utils.o
|
| H A D | za-ptrace.c | 63 struct user_za_header *za; in get_za() local 65 size_t sz = sizeof(*za); in get_za() 85 za = *buf; in get_za() 86 if (za->size <= sz) in get_za() 89 sz = za->size; in get_za() 92 return za; in get_za() 103 iov.iov_len = za->size; in set_za() 110 struct user_za_header za; in ptrace_set_get_vl() local 127 memset(&za, 0, sizeof(za)); in ptrace_set_get_vl() 128 za.size = sizeof(za); in ptrace_set_get_vl() [all …]
|
| H A D | zt-ptrace.c | 58 struct user_za_header *za; in get_za() local 60 size_t sz = sizeof(*za); in get_za() 80 za = *buf; in get_za() 81 if (za->size <= sz) in get_za() 84 sz = za->size; in get_za() 87 return za; in get_za() 98 iov.iov_len = za->size; in set_za() 124 struct user_za_header za; in ptrace_za_disabled_read_zt() local 130 memset(&za, 0, sizeof(za)); in ptrace_za_disabled_read_zt() 131 za.vl = sme_vl; in ptrace_za_disabled_read_zt() [all …]
|
| H A D | .gitignore | 14 za-fork 15 za-ptrace 16 za-test
|
| H A D | fp-ptrace.c | 554 struct user_za_header *za; in check_ptrace_values_za() local 580 za = iov.iov_base; in check_ptrace_values_za() 582 if (za->vl != config->sme_vl_in) { in check_ptrace_values_za() 590 if (za->size != ZA_PT_SIZE(vq)) { in check_ptrace_values_za() 601 if (za->size != sizeof(*za)) { in check_ptrace_values_za() 603 za->size, sizeof(*za)); in check_ptrace_values_za() 1243 struct user_za_header *za; in za_write() local 1252 iov.iov_len = sizeof(*za); in za_write() 1261 za = iov.iov_base; in za_write() 1262 za->size = iov.iov_len; in za_write() [all …]
|
| H A D | za-stress | 45 ./za-test >$log &
|
| /linux-6.15/tools/testing/selftests/arm64/signal/testcases/ |
| H A D | za_regs.c | 49 struct za_context *za; in do_one_sme_vl() local 72 za = (struct za_context *)head; in do_one_sme_vl() 73 if (za->vl != vl) { in do_one_sme_vl() 74 fprintf(stderr, "Got VL %d, expected %d\n", za->vl, vl); in do_one_sme_vl() 85 head->size, za->vl); in do_one_sme_vl() 88 if (memcmp(zeros, (char *)za + ZA_SIG_REGS_OFFSET, in do_one_sme_vl() 89 ZA_SIG_REGS_SIZE(sve_vq_from_vl(za->vl))) != 0) { in do_one_sme_vl()
|
| H A D | ssve_za_regs.c | 54 struct za_context *za; in do_one_sme_vl() local 101 za = (struct za_context *)regs; in do_one_sme_vl() 102 if (za->vl != vl) { in do_one_sme_vl() 103 fprintf(stderr, "Got ZA VL %d, expected %d\n", za->vl, vl); in do_one_sme_vl() 108 regs->size, za->vl); in do_one_sme_vl() 111 if (memcmp(zeros, (char *)za + ZA_SIG_REGS_OFFSET, in do_one_sme_vl() 112 ZA_SIG_REGS_SIZE(sve_vq_from_vl(za->vl))) != 0) { in do_one_sme_vl()
|
| H A D | testcases.c | 63 bool validate_za_context(struct za_context *za, char **err) in validate_za_context() argument 67 = ((ZA_SIG_CONTEXT_SIZE(sve_vq_from_vl(za->vl)) + 15) / 16) * 16; in validate_za_context() 69 if (!za || !err) in validate_za_context() 73 if ((za->head.size != sizeof(struct za_context)) && in validate_za_context() 74 (za->head.size != regs_size)) { in validate_za_context() 79 if (!sve_vl_valid(za->vl)) { in validate_za_context() 116 struct za_context *za = NULL; in validate_reserved() local 183 za = (struct za_context *)head; in validate_reserved() 263 if (!validate_za_context(za, err)) in validate_reserved()
|
| H A D | za_no_regs.c | 41 struct za_context *za; in do_one_sme_vl() local 63 za = (struct za_context *)head; in do_one_sme_vl() 64 if (za->vl != vl) { in do_one_sme_vl() 65 fprintf(stderr, "Got VL %d, expected %d\n", za->vl, vl); in do_one_sme_vl() 77 head->size, za->vl); in do_one_sme_vl()
|
| H A D | sme_vl.c | 34 struct za_context *za; in sme_vl() local 46 za = (struct za_context *)head; in sme_vl() 48 if (za->vl != vl) { in sme_vl() 50 za->vl, vl); in sme_vl()
|
| H A D | fake_sigreturn_sme_change_vl.c | 38 struct za_context *za; in fake_sigreturn_ssve_change_vl() local 56 za = (struct za_context *)head; in fake_sigreturn_ssve_change_vl() 60 za->vl, vls[0]); in fake_sigreturn_ssve_change_vl() 61 za->vl = vls[0]; in fake_sigreturn_ssve_change_vl()
|
| /linux-6.15/drivers/isdn/hardware/mISDN/ |
| H A D | hfcpci.c | 343 bzr->za[MAX_B_FRAMES].z2 = cpu_to_le16( in hfcpci_clear_fifo_rx() 344 le16_to_cpu(bzr->za[MAX_B_FRAMES].z1)); in hfcpci_clear_fifo_rx() 416 bz->za[new_f2].z2 = cpu_to_le16(new_z2); in hfcpci_empty_bfifo() 443 bz->za[new_f2].z2 = cpu_to_le16(new_z2); in hfcpci_empty_bfifo() 465 zp = &df->za[df->f2 & D_FREG_MASK]; in receive_dmsg() 491 df->za[df->f2 & D_FREG_MASK].z2 = in receive_dmsg() 544 z1t = &txbz->za[MAX_B_FRAMES].z1; in hfcpci_empty_fifo_trans() 625 zp = &rxbz->za[rxbz->f2]; in main_rec_hfcpci() 769 z1t = &bz->za[MAX_B_FRAMES].z1; in hfcpci_fill_fifo() 852 bz->za[bz->f1].z1); in hfcpci_fill_fifo() [all …]
|
| H A D | hfc_pci.h | 182 struct zt za[MAX_D_FRAMES + 1]; member 187 struct zt za[MAX_B_FRAMES + 1]; /* only range 0x0..0x1F allowed */ member
|
| /linux-6.15/arch/arm64/kernel/ |
| H A D | signal.c | 235 struct za_context __user *za; member 563 if (user->za_size < sizeof(*user->za)) in restore_za_context() 566 __get_user_error(user_vl, &(user->za->vl), err); in restore_za_context() 573 if (user->za_size == sizeof(*user->za)) { in restore_za_context() 601 (char __user const *)user->za + in restore_za_context() 782 user->za = NULL; in parse_user_sigframe() 874 if (user->za) in parse_user_sigframe() 877 user->za = (struct za_context __user *)head; in parse_user_sigframe() 1043 if (err == 0 && system_supports_sme() && user.za) in restore_sigframe()
|
| /linux-6.15/Documentation/hwmon/ |
| H A D | lm92.rst | 32 - Abraham van der Merwe <[email protected].za>
|
| H A D | max1668.rst | 16 David George <[email protected].za>
|
| /linux-6.15/Documentation/trace/ |
| H A D | function-graph-fold.vim | 5 " use the usual vim fold commands, such as "za", to open and close nested
|
| /linux-6.15/Documentation/driver-api/media/drivers/ |
| H A D | radiotrack.rst | 14 ([email protected].za or [email protected].za) in 1994, and elaborations from
|
| /linux-6.15/arch/s390/pci/ |
| H A D | pci.c | 1104 struct zpci_dev *za = container_of(a, struct zpci_dev, entry); in zpci_cmp_rid() local 1111 if (za->rid == zb->rid) in zpci_cmp_rid() 1112 return za->rid_available > zb->rid_available; in zpci_cmp_rid() 1116 return za->rid > zb->rid; in zpci_cmp_rid()
|
| /linux-6.15/Documentation/admin-guide/ |
| H A D | devices.rst | 252 a master side, named ``/dev/pty[p-za-e][0-9a-f]``, and a slave side, named 253 ``/dev/tty[p-za-e][0-9a-f]``. The kernel arbitrates the use of PTYs by
|
| /linux-6.15/drivers/nvme/target/ |
| H A D | zns.c | 234 zdesc.za = z->reset ? 1 << 2 : 0; in nvmet_bdev_report_zone_cb()
|
| /linux-6.15/include/linux/ |
| H A D | nvme.h | 774 __u8 za; member
|
| /linux-6.15/ |
| H A D | CREDITS | 1475 E: [email protected].za 4110 E: [email protected].za 4111 W: http://maxim.org.za/at91_26.html
|